Skip to main content

PDF アノテーション削除ツール アノテーションを削除します。

PDF アノテーション削除ツール illustration
📄

PDF アノテーション削除ツール

アノテーションを削除します。

1

PDFをアップロード

アップロードエリアにファイルをドロップして、文書を読み込みます。

2

注釈を削除

「注釈を削除」をクリックしてPDFを処理し、すべてのページから注釈を削除します。

3

ダウンロード

「ダウンロード」をクリックして、注釈が削除されたファイルを保存します。

Loading tool...

What Is PDF アノテーション削除ツール?

PDFアノテーションリムーバーは、Portable Document Format(PDF)ファイルからアノテーションを削除するソフトウェアアプリケーションです。ユーザーが不要なマークやコメントなしで既存のドキュメントをクリーンアップして再利用できるようにします。開発者やドキュメント編集者は、PDFを公開または共有するために使用し、アノテーションを手動で削除するという特定の問題を解決します。これは時間がかかり、エラーが発生しやすいためです。

このツールは、ブラウザ内で直接動作するクライアントサイドソリューションを提供し、機密情報を外部サーバーにアップロードする必要性を排除します。特徴的なのは、PDFドキュメントのすべてのページから自動的にアノテーションを検出して削除できることです。これは、`doc.getPages()`を使用して各ページを繰り返し処理し、'Annots'ノードを削除するコードで見られるようにしています。

ツールのオンラインインターフェイスでは、ユーザーがPDFファイルをドラッグアンドドロップして、アノテーションの数を見て、1回のクリックで削除できます。結果として、すぐにダウンロードできるクリーンなPDFファイルが生成されます。このプロセスは、`pdf-lib`などのライブラリを使用することで実現されており、PDFドキュメントの効率的な読み込み、処理、および保存を可能にします。FreeToolkitの無料オンラインツールとして、アノテーションを削除するために追加のソフトウェアをインストールしたり、プレミアムサービスを支払ったりしなくても、PDFアノテーションを簡単に削除できるため、ユーザーにとって魅力的な選択肢となっています。

Why Use PDF アノテーション削除ツール?

  • シンプルなインターフェースで注釈を削除
  • クライアントサイド
  • 無料
  • ワンクリックでのダウンロード

Common Use Cases

開発

日常的な使用。

レビュー

検証。

ドキュメント

設定。

学習

インタラクティブ。

Technical Guide

PDFアノテーションの削除プロセスは、ユーザーがFileDropzoneコンポーネントにPDFファイルをドロップしたときに開始され、`handleFile`関数が呼び出されて、`pdf-lib`の`PDFDocument.load`メソッドでドキュメントを読み込みます。このメソッドでは、`ignoreEncryption`をtrueに設定して、アノテーションを含むドキュメント構造にアクセスします。コードは各ページを繰り返し処理するために`doc.getPages()`を使用し、'Annots'ノードがPDFArrayであるかどうかを確認して、アノテーションの数をカウントします。

ユーザーが「アノテーションを削除」ボタンをクリックすると、`process`関数が呼び出されて、`pdf-lib`でPDFドキュメントを読み込み、各ページの'Annots'ノードを削除します。更新されたドキュメントは`doc.save()`で保存され、結果として得られるバイナリデータはMIMEタイプapplication/pdfを持つBlobオブジェクトに変換されます。このBlobは、URLを作成するために使用され、ユーザーがダウンロードできます。これは、`URL.createObjectURL`メソッドとHTMLAnchorElementインターフェイスを使用して実現されています。

ツールでは、Reactの`useState`フックを使用して、アップロードされたファイル、ページ数、アノテーション数、処理ステータス、結果URL、およびエラーメッセージを状態に保存します。`useCallback`フックは、`handleFile`、`process`、`download`、`reset`などの関数をメモ化するために使用され、これらの関数が不要に再作成されることを防ぎ、パフォーマンスを向上させます。また、コードではレスポンシブUIテクニックを採用して、さまざまな画面サイズやデバイスに対応し、ユーザーにシームレスなエクスペリエンスを提供します。

Tips & Best Practices

  • 1
    PDFファイルをアップロードした後、「注釈を削除」ボタンをクリックしてすべての注釈を削除します
  • 2
    ツールをリセットするために「リセット」ボタンをクリックして、新しいPDFファイルをアップロードします
  • 3
    処理前に注釈数を確認して、正しい削除を確実に行います
  • 4
    処理が成功した後、「クリーンPDFをダウンロード」ボタンを使用してクリーンなPDFファイルをダウンロードします
  • 5
    処理に失敗した場合は、ボタンの下に表示されるエラーを確認します
  • 6
    FileDropzoneコンポーネントの'.pdf,application/pdf'受け入れフィルターによって指定されたPDFファイルのみをアップロードしてください

Related Tools

Frequently Asked Questions

Q PDF注釈削除ツールは無料ですか?
はい、無料です。
Q 私のPDFをアップロードしますか?
いいえ。すべての処理はブラウザ内で実行されます。
Q オフラインで使用できますか?
はい。
Q どのブラウザがサポートされていますか?
すべてのモダンブラウザ。
Q 商用PDFに使用できますか?
はい。

About This Tool

PDF アノテーション削除ツール is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.